user_0815 Posted April 18, 2023 Share Posted April 18, 2023 Hi, I'm trying to convert a letter which has an outline into a curve. This curve I want to substract from a solid shape. Currently the letter loses it's outline when I try to substract it (no matter curve or text), which is not the desired result. How can I substract a letter with outline from a shape? Or do I need a different way of doing it?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Staff NathanC Posted April 18, 2023 Staff Share Posted April 18, 2023 Hi @user_0815, Strokes on objects are not factored into boolean operations, if you wanted the outline/stroke area on your curve to be included when you subtract you could expand the stroke first so it creates a closed shape, and then add the expanded stroke with the original shape and then finally subtract it from your shape, I've attached a brief recording demonstrating this.
